Onboarding: HaulMetric Fuel Report

Weekly fleet fuel-usage report for the Dray & Vessel ops team. Source: telematics export from the Kestrel depot gateway. Pipeline runs Mondays 04:00; output lands in the ops bucket as a signed CSV bundle. Never edit the generated file by hand. Re-runs require re-signing. The signing key used by the pipeline is:

release key, fahaf-bajof: bky3_Xam

## Canary Gating — Quickstone Deploys

Canaries get 5% of traffic. Promotion is automatic only if all gates pass for 30 minutes: error rate, p99 latency, and saturation. Any gate failure rolls back without asking. Do not override gates manually; ping the release captain instead. Gate thresholds are owned by the Harrowell platform team. Current gating configuration values are listed below.

service settings:
[casax]
port = 6379
team = rusir
host = casax.zemvarhq.corp
region = outer-4
access_code = ac_9808ce
timeout_ms = 1500

## Runbook: TrailScribe Offline Mode

TrailScribe field clients buffer survey entries locally when connectivity drops, then replay to the sync service on reconnect. Replay order is strict; do not purge the local queue manually. If replays stall, check the conflict log before forcing a flush. The replay admin endpoint requires internal service auth — use the key below.

app token of badug-tahaf = qvz11-nP5FBNr8qnh

# Skylark Environments: Cold Starts

Quick note for the sync: our serverless handlers in the staging tier have been cold-starting badly since we bumped the runtime image. P99 init times roughly doubled, mostly from dependency loading in the render path. We've enabled pre-warmed pools in prod and are trialing them in staging this week — watch the dashboards before flipping anything else. The warm-pool sizing and timeout behavior for each environment is controlled by the values below.

deployment values, faduf-tawep:
SORDOR_LOG_LEVEL=error
SORDOR_METRICS_HOST=metrics.sordor.nelvrolabs.internal
SORDOR_POOL_SIZE=4